Located 26 miles southwest of Miami, Homestead sits between two natural wonders - Biscayne National Park and Everglades National Park. The city offers diverse housing options from downtown apartments to residential communities throughout its neighborhoods. Current rental rates show one-bedroom units averaging $1,399 per month and two-bedroom homes at $1,771. The historic downtown district features the beautifully restored Seminole Theatre, while the area near Homestead-Miami Speedway draws racing fans throughout the racing season.
Homestead balances small-town atmosphere with convenient access to Miami's amenities and outdoor recreation. The Fruit and Spice Park spans 37 acres, showcasing tropical plants and agriculture native to South Florida. Local agriculture remains central to the community, highlighted by seasonal farmers' markets and Knaus Berry Farm's beloved baked goods and U-pick fields. Miami-Dade College's Homestead Campus serves the educational needs of residents.
